Wed, 11 May 2016 14:18:52 -0700 localrepo: use dirstate savebackup instead of handling dirstate file manually
Mateusz Kwapich <mitrandir@fb.com> [Wed, 11 May 2016 14:18:52 -0700] rev 29191
localrepo: use dirstate savebackup instead of handling dirstate file manually This is one step towards having dirstate manage its own storage. It will be useful for the implementation of sql dirstate [1]. This introduced a small test change: now we always write the dirstate before saving backup so in some cases where dirstate file didn't exist yet savebackup can create it. Fri, 13 May 2016 13:30:08 -0700 localrepo: use dirstate restorebackup instead of copying dirstate manually
Mateusz Kwapich <mitrandir@fb.com> [Fri, 13 May 2016 13:30:08 -0700] rev 29190
localrepo: use dirstate restorebackup instead of copying dirstate manually This is one step towards having dirstate manage its own storage. It will be useful for the implementation of sqldirstate [1]. I'm deleting two of the dirstate.invalidate() calls in localrepo because restorebackup method does that for us.
